We study holomorphic Poisson manifolds and holomorphic Lie algebroids from the viewpoint of real Poisson geometry. We give a characterization of holomorphic Poisson structures in terms of the Poisson Nijenhuis structures of Magri-Morosi and describe a double complex which computes the holomorphic Poisson cohomology. We introduce the notion of Glanon groupoids, which are Lie groupoids equipped with multiplicative generalized complex structures. We introduce the notion of skew-holomorphic Lie algebroid on a complex manifold, and explore some cohomologies theories that one can associate to it. Examples are given in terms of holomorphic Poisson structures of various sorts.

In this note, we study the Koszul-Brylinski homology of holomorphic Poisson manifolds. We show that it is isomorphic to the cohomology of a certain smooth complex Lie algebroid with values in the Evens-Lu-Weinstein duality module. In this thesis, we study deformations of compact holomorphic Poisson manifolds and algebraic Poisson schemes in the framework of Kodaira-Spencer's analytic deformation theory and Grothendieck's algebraic deformation theory.
